Two Postdoc positions have opened at PSI!

 

As part of the CORTEX project, The Paul Scherrer Institut (PSI) has opened two Postdoc positions:
  • The 1st one concerning Numerical Noise Modelling and Simulations
==> The tasks:
– Further development of PSI methodologies for numerical modelling and simulations of reactor noise
– Validation of simulated neutron noise signatures against experimental data
– Generation of large sets of simulated noise data and assessment of machine learning algorithms for localisation and characterisation of noise sources
– Contribution to the EURATOM CORTEX project
– Presentation of results in scientific publications and project reports
– Participation to education activities and to the elaboration of research proposals
  • The 2nd one concerning Reactor core Analysis
==> The tasks:
– Establishment of reference core analysis methodology with CASMO-5/SIMULATE-5 codes for the Swiss BWRs
– Development of advanced verification and validation procedures for Swiss LWR core simulations based on trend and correlation analyses with data science techniques
– Advancement of higher-resolution 3D pin-by-pin core simulators without spatial homogenisation for steady-state and transient analysis of current and innovative PWRs
– Presentation of results in scientific publications and project reports
– Participation to education activities and to the elaboration of research proposals
